Route through the Lowlands of The River Güeña
Kilometers Duration
33 4 hours
Route Description
 

After walking along the 5 km that separate Cangas de Onís from Corao, take the main road towards Corao-Castle. Here, continue on along a trail that leads you to Táranu. This point can be reached along another alternative route that passes through Labra.

From Táranu, pass through Llenín and you will come to Cuerres.

After returning to Llenín, take a trail that leads you to Beceña. Continue on along the route towards San Martín de Grazanes.

 

Take then asphalted road that leads to Mestas de Con, one of the most important towns in the Municipality of Cangas de Onís.

From Mestas, take a minor road towards Soto de Ensertal and Intriago. At this point, there are two alternatives:

  1. You can either leave the main road and continue along it until you reach Cangas de Onís.

  2. Or head towards Teleña, and then take a path towards Abamia. From there, to Corao and then along the main road to Cangas de Onís.
